Lakhimpur violence: Here’s why Mantri Ajay Mishra’s son & the main accused got bail | 5 points

The Allahabad High Court on Thursday granted bail to the main accused in Lakhimpur Kheri violence and Union Minister Ajay Mishra Teni's son - Ashish. The high court questioned the charges against him and rejected the police probe. However, Ashish Mishra won't step out of the jail just yet because the High Court hasn't granted him bail on all sections he has been charged with. A closer look at the HC order reveals that it does not mention IPC section 302 and 120 B, which are the two sections pertaining to murder and criminal conspiracy.
